Abstract

In recent years the hue and cry of American industry concerning the pressure of foreign competition on the domestic marketplace has become all too familiar to most of us, as we are all well aware, the steel industry has not been exempted from this pressure, reduced production levels, work force cutbacks, and in some extreme cases, plant closings and company liquidations have resulted, new regulations governing imports and quotas have been enacted, foreign trade agreements reached, and more strict regulation enforcement practices undertaken, despite these, and other measures, the impact of aggressive foreign competition has not lessened, the concensus of numerous management consultants is that in order to successfully cope with these problems we must draw on all available technology to provide the tools which will enable us to enhance our management effectiveness, one area requiring particularly close attention in any mining operation is that of managing critical resources - namely time, energy and equipment in a fast and efficient manner, In mining, with critical resources deployed over a large geographical area, any degree of success involved with resource management is dependent upon knowing the current status of all work related activities, if we, as mine operators, are to be more successful in this area, additional tools are a necessity and modern technology has provided a multitude of new options from which to choose.
